Shodo Harada is a prominent contemporary Zen master known for his deep understanding and teachings of Zen Buddhism. He was born in Fukuoka, Japan, and has dedicated his life to the practice and dissemination of Zen teachings. Harada is the abbot of Sōgen-ji, a Zen temple in Okayama, where he has trained numerous students from around the world. His teachings emphasize the importance of direct experience and the practice of zazen, or seated meditation, as a means to attain enlightenment.
Harada is also an author, having written several influential texts on Zen practice, including "Not One Single Thing: A Commentary on the Platform Sutra" and "Morning Dewdrops of the Mind: Teachings of a Contemporary Zen Master." His works reflect his commitment to making Zen accessible to modern practitioners and explore the interplay between traditional teachings and contemporary life. Harada's influence extends beyond Japan, as he has traveled extensively, sharing his insights and practices with a global audience.
